The 1911 Currie Cup was the tenth edition of the Currie Cup, the premier domestic rugby union competition in South Africa.
The tournament was won by Template:Rut Griqualand West for the second time, who won six of their matches in the competition and drew the other match.[1]
This tournament also marked the first ever loss for Template:Rut Western Province, who previously went 48 matches unbeaten in the competition since its inception in 1892, winning 46 and drawing two of those matches.[1] Template:Rut Griqualand West beat them 12–0 in the tournament held in Cape Town.[2]
